Freedom From Religion Foundation Commercial on CBS Evening News

For once, a commercial during a news broadcast may have been as notable as the news itself.  The Freedom From Religion Foundation aired a 30-second commercial at the third break, during the CBS Evening News with Scott Pelley.  Not an event we see very often, but in light of the Reason Rally and the seeming lack of mainstream news coverage it got, perhaps this makes up for it, if only a little.
